About the technology

What it covers

Data pipelines move data from source systems into the tools people use for analysis, reporting, and operations. They are built for batch jobs, streaming flows, ETL, ELT, and data integration work across warehouses, lakes, and dashboards.

Typical work

  • Connect APIs, databases, files, and event streams
  • Clean, transform, and validate incoming data
  • Load data into warehouses or lakehouse stacks
  • Monitor failures, delays, and schema changes

Common stack

A strong specialist knows tools such as Airflow, dbt, Kafka, Spark, Fivetran, and cloud services like AWS, Azure, or GCP. They also understand orchestration, scheduling, partitioning, lineage, and how to keep pipelines testable and maintainable.

When companies hire

Companies bring in freelance expertise when a pipeline is slow, brittle, or hard to extend. They also do it for new analytics platforms, migration projects, and urgent fixes after broken jobs or bad source data.

What strong specialists do

Good professionals design for failure, not just for the happy path. They document dependencies, add checks, keep transformations readable, and hand over systems that teams can run without guesswork. In Cologne, this often matters for commerce, logistics, media, and industrial data teams that need clear collaboration with local or remote specialists.

What to expect

A good engagement starts with source systems, data quality, freshness needs, and the target architecture. The best experts ask about ownership, alerting, access, and who consumes the outputs. That keeps the pipeline practical, stable, and easy to evolve.

A strong Data Pipeline turns raw source data into usable data for reporting, analytics, machine learning, and operational systems. It can move data in batches, in near real time, or both, depending on how the business uses it. The goal is clean, reliable flow from source to target.

Not exactly. Data Pipeline is the broader term; ETL and ELT describe common ways to move and transform data inside that pipeline. Many teams still use ETL when transformations happen before loading and ELT when the warehouse does the heavy lifting.

A Data Pipeline specialist often works with Airflow, dbt, Kafka, Spark, and cloud data services. Useful adjacent skills include SQL, data modeling, orchestration, monitoring, and basic Python or Scala for transformation logic. The best fit depends on whether the pipeline is batch, streaming, or hybrid.

A Data Pipeline project can be simple or highly complex, so the right level depends on the sources, volume, freshness, and reliability needs. Small reporting flows need practical setup and good data checks. Larger systems need specialists who can handle retries, lineage, access control, and incident response.

Bring in a Data Pipeline specialist when internal teams are overloaded, the current flow keeps breaking, or a new data platform needs to go live quickly. Freelancers are also useful for migrations, cloud moves, and cleanup work after years of ad hoc scripts. They can focus on delivery without long onboarding.

Most Data Pipeline work can be done remotely because the core tasks are design, coding, testing, and coordination. On-site time in Cologne can help when access to stakeholders, legacy systems, or sensitive internal data is easier in person. Many teams use a mixed setup.

Look for a Data Pipeline specialist who explains trade-offs clearly and shows how they handle failures, testing, and monitoring. Good signs include clean SQL, readable transformation logic, and a practical approach to source quality and ownership. Ask for examples of systems they kept stable over time.

Data Pipeline work is one part of data engineering, focused on moving and shaping data across systems. A broader data engineering profile may also cover modeling, platform design, governance, and analytics enablement. If the project is mainly about reliable data flow, a pipeline specialist is often the best fit.
